Public Profile
In April 2005, Tetrad Corporation was acquired by WL Gore & Associates.Tetrad manufactures medical ultrasound probes and imaging systems for end users and original equipment manufacturers. The firm began as a contract engineering firm specializing in medical ultrasound providing design services to most of the major ultrasound companies. Tetrad built several generations of Doppler modules and imaging front ends introducing the first rigid laparoscopic ultrasound probe in 1992. Tetrad launched internal transducer development and manufacturing operations in 1993 and introduced the first "point and shoot" ultrasound system for surgery. They then pioneered several innovative probe concepts such as articulated rotating laparoscopic probes, integrated laparoscopic biopsy, and miniature 5mm laparoscopic probes along with the concept of fully sealed ultrasound probes, including the connector, for compatibility with Steris® and other sterilization methods. The firm's personnel are currently working on state-of-the-art developments in composite transducers, 1.5D probes, integrated miniature multiplexers, single crystal relaxor piezoelectric materials, and embedded ultrasound systems, offering the industry advanced design and manufacturing capabilities in standard probes, laparoscopic and open surgery probes, 1.5D probes with integrated electronics, and embedded ultrasound systems
